Requirements for a Portuguese Tourist Visa ApplicationThe following nationals must apply in person for their Portugal Visas:Afghanistan, Albania, Algeria, Bahrain, Bangladesh, Belarus, Burundi, China, Colombia, Democratic Republic of Congo, Ecuador, Egypt, Hong Kong CID, Frandesspas Document, Indonesia, Iran , Iraq, Jordan, Kazakstan, Kosovo, Kuwait, Lebanon, Libya, Nigeria, N. Korea, Oman, Pakistan, Palestine, Philippines, Qatar, Travel Document holders, Tunisia, Rwanda, Saudi Arabia, Siera Leone, Somalia, Sri Lanka, Sudan, Surinam, Syria, United Arab Emirates, Vietnam, Yemen, Zambia, Zimbabwe For all other nationalities please see the requirements below

Spouse/Family member of EU NationalSpouse/Family member of EU National - If you are married to/dependant on British/Irish national please contact The Schengen Office to discuss your requirements. Marriage Certificates/Birth Certificates that require translations HAVE TO BE notarised by the Embassy of the person’s nationality. Portuguese Visa Fees:Official Schengen visa fee is: €60 (approx. £58) *Note: Includes €60 Embassy fee If you require passport to be posted to you additional £6.00 will be charged.
